China's Tianwen-1 probe has successfully entered orbit around Mars after a nearly seven-month voyage from Earth.
Key points:
It will now start looking for places to land
A UAE probe is also in orbit around the Red Planet, with a NASA mission on the way
China's National Space Administration (CNSA) said the spaceship began decelerating on its approach to the Red Planet on Wednesday evening, Beijing time.
